Hirokazu Sawamura made his second spring appearance on Monday as he looks to hopefully play a big role in the Red Sox bullpen this year. The early looks have not been good, but the team isn’t really surprised there’s been an adjustment period. (Peter Abraham; Boston Globe)

Over in the rotation, the performances have been mostly good, which is a very nice thing to see after the dumpster fire that was last season. Alex Cora has commented on how deep the group looks right now. (Jacob Camenker; NBC Sports Boston)

As deep as it may be, especially relative to last season, it’s still largely average and the team will need its offense to compete. (Jason Mastrodonato; Boston Herald)

The Red Sox provided some injury updates on Monday, including news that Danny Santana had to be admitted to the hospital with a foot infection. (Christopher Smith; Masslive)
